Transaction 1504a31420f81a08b2fabb0a6e020dcfe1e887bc4cd36a73aaa91eeca9a062ef

1 Input
2 Outputs
  • 1504a31420f81a08b2fabb0a6e020dcfe1e887bc4cd36a73aaa91eeca9a062ef:0
  • value  17628809964
    address  15ymM5ijPAA7KH1DsZBPwoBtV9NpuqczMk
  • 1504a31420f81a08b2fabb0a6e020dcfe1e887bc4cd36a73aaa91eeca9a062ef:1
  • value  88760067
    address  1F5PueACDZFrF4AHMggCNU9G2Wg2avunvc